Waveny Park, New Canaan, CT: Maria & Delfim's Engagement Session Friday, July 6, 2012

It wasn't love at first site for Maria and Del, those many years ago. That would be too fleeting, too temperamental. What they felt was different and, in some ways, something deeper. That first meeting twenty years ago ignited a spark, a connection that neither of them could name but both could feel. It wasn't love, not then. It was more like the recognition of a kindred spirit. In one another they had found a friend, someone who understood the importance of family. Someone who loved to pack a bag, get on a plane and see the world. Someone who saw the value in working hard and chasing your dreams. Someone with whom you could savor a delicious meal, sip on a nice glass of wine and just be yourself. Isn't that someone we would all look for? In one another, Maria and Del had found just that.

But they didn't know it. Not back then, anyway. Back in the '90's they had the same group of friends and felt that connection between one another. But they didn't act on it. It was just friendship. A special friendship that they cherished, but nothing more.

They say that time changes everything. And too often when we hear that phrase we think of the things that change for the worse. But just as often, it can mean that things can change for the better. Friendships can grow. Connections can turn from something undefinable to something undeniable. And that's just how it was for Maria and Del. It took them over a decade, but they figured it out. They realized that what they had was something special, something real, something that they wanted to nurture and grow. Once they became a couple, it was as though the whole world finally made sense. Now they have someone to share their family with. Someone to travel with. Someone to be there at home to talk to after a long day at work. Someone to encourage them to chase their dreams. Someone to cook them a delicious meal and pour them a nice glass of wine. Someone who loves them for exactly who they are. And has, for years. Even if they didn't know what to call it at first.
